What is Nike Dunk Low Pink Velvet?
Nike Dunk Low Pink Velvet is more than just a sneaker — it’s a statement piece. Released as a grade school (GS) exclusive on February 3, 2022, this shoe blends bold femininity with classic basketball heritage. Featuring a soft pink velvet overlay, leather base, and signature Swoosh branding, it offers the perfect mix of elegance and edge. Its low-top cut keeps things casual, while the unique materials give it an elevated, standout vibe. Nike Dunk Low Pink Velvet Key Features
Velvet Upper: The star of the show — plush pink velvet that adds a luxe, soft touch.
Low-Cut Build: Offers ankle freedom and a sleek profile, perfect for everyday wear.
Durable Sole: Rubber outsole ensures great traction and lasting wear.
Crisp Details: Embroidered branding, shiny heel tab, and layered textures give it depth and personality.
Versatile Appeal: While it’s a GS release, it has massive appeal across all ages thanks to its thoughtful design and vibrant color.
How to Style Nike Dunk Low Pink Velvet?
1. Cute & Casual
Go for a pastel aesthetic by pairing it with a light pink cropped hoodie and a pleated mini skirt. Add white crew socks to highlight the shoe.
2. Sporty Cool
Try it with grey sweatpants or black cargo joggers and a matching pink tee or tank. Throw on a cap or mini backpack to complete the streetwear look.
3. Feminine & Flowing
A soft floral dress or long shirt dress in muted tones will contrast the chunky silhouette beautifully. Layer with a denim jacket for cool-weather days.
4. Monochrome Minimalism
Black jeans and a simple white top can really let the pink pop. Add a silver chain or minimalist tote for a polished finish.
Tip: Because of the shoe’s bold texture and color, keep the rest of your outfit balanced. Let the sneakers speak for themselves.
